Machine Learning is a subset of Artificial Intelligence that allows systems to automatically learn and improve from experience without being explicitly programmed. It uses algorithms and statistical models to identify patterns in data, enabling predictive analysis and decision-making. Over time, these systems enhance their accuracy and performance by adapting to new data inputs.